Holland 

System: Great Battles 1939-45 (WB-95)

Complexity: medium

Scale: Division-regiment

Scenarios: 2

Description: 

The last offensive of the German army was a complete surprise for the Western Allies, both in terms of location and time. Two panzer armies (5th and 6th SS) were dispat­ched on the western borders of Germany and were to make quick attacks on the contact points of the Allied armies and to pincer the American forces of the 1st and 9th Armies. The plan was risky, because two parallel attacks were to be made. The first one was aimed at Liege -Bostogne, and the second one at Maastricht. If the planned attacks were successful, the situation of the Americans would be very difficult. They would find themselves surrounded without any available supply routes.  Patton’s 3rd Army and the 7th Army further south would remain outside the cauldron. But would they be able to launch a counterattack from the south quickly enough? However, the Allies cannot be condemned to defeat so quickly. They have significant forces in the areas of the German attack and, if used well, Germans can suffer a devastating defeat. In the scenario, we allow for offensive operations in southern Holland, where the Germans have only launched binding attacks.
